Off-Site Run Checklist — Item 4: Survey Instrument Crate

Okay, this is the big wooden crate from Marrowfield Geomatics — theodolites and two levels, all calibrated last week, so treat it gently. Check the tilt indicators on both sides before it leaves; if either one's tripped, flag it and don't ship. Records team: photograph the seals, file the packing list copy, and note crate weight on the run sheet. Pickup window is 09:00–09:30 at Dock B. The confidential hand-over line for the courier appears immediately below this item.

handover note for bajog-tawig: the lamion quenael courier leaves the wendor ledger at gate 1289 under passcode 760784

## Break-Glass: Conversion Rounding Audit

If the Marivel ledger shows rounding drift above 0.5 basis points in currency conversion, break-glass access to the rate-adjustment console is authorized. Document the drift amount, affected pairs, and reviewer approval before proceeding. To unseal the console, the steward must supply the recovery passphrase recorded below.

vault phrase of kahip-bajog = praath-gordor-juleth-istys-quenion

Ticket #4182 — Encoding misdetection on upload. Product: TextVault by Norrell Systems. Steps: 1) Upload a UTF-16LE file without BOM via the web form. 2) Open the preview pane. 3) Observe garbled characters; detector falls back to Latin-1. Expected: UTF-16 detection via heuristic sampling. To reproduce against staging, authenticate with the token below.

session JWT of yawep-yawep = eyJhbGciOiJIUzI1NiIsInR5cCI6IkpXVCJ9.eyJzdWIiOiI3pWF3_In0.aXYsHiog

## Dark mode on Brindlecone Admin

If users report the dashboard flashing white on load, it's almost always the theme resolver cache going stale after a deploy. Quick fix: restart the theme-svc pod and hard-refresh. Don't touch the palette overrides in the DB unless Marisol signs off — they're shared with the Quillhaven tenant. The toggle itself lives behind a flag, so check that first. Here are the current values the resolver reads at boot:

service settings:
[casax]
port = 6379
team = rusir
host = casax.zemvarhq.corp
region = outer-4
access_code = ac_9808ce
timeout_ms = 1500